ABOUT THE ARTWORK
DETAILS AND DIMENSIONS
SHIPPING AND RETURNS

Living in a desolate bay on the Cape Peninsula, the waves pounded during a stormy winter. Influenced by the 18C Japanese woodprint and painted in a abstract fashion, it was created to evoke the sound of the sea as the sun set.

About the Artist

Karen Cochlovius

South Africa

My (Karen Cochlovius) paintings are about creating sanctuaries for both me the painter and you the viewer. You are urged to step into the painting for further discovery; what lies beyond that alley, whose shadow is behind you, what drifts beyond the water?

My paintings are vibrant, colourful with an undercurrent of adventure. Nature and travel - where the discoveries of the unexpected are found - inspire me. As a story teller by heart (I have published one novel, and in the process of approaching publishers with the second), I know that even in places where wind bends trees, rivers wash blood and mist engulfs, there is a feeling of resilience and ultimate safety in my land and cityscapes.

I usually distort perspective and carefully consider composition to pull the onlooker into the story and my titles often come to me before the painting, and I consider them as carefully as the painting. You may notice there are few or no people in most of my paintings, leaving the onlooker to experience the sanctuary in privacy.

I draw inspiration from a variety of styles of painting from Egon Schiele, Peter Doig, the use of colour from Jaquim Mir, the movement of the sculptures of Salvadore Dali, the emotion of Van Gogh's trees.

I have a background in science (I worked and travelled in Africa as an exploration geologist for 20 years as well), although I have always painted and wrote. I am more inclined to spend my time with the arts now, feeding the science into my creativity.
